Who: #1 United States vs. #15 China PR
When: Wednesday, December 16, 5 PM PT / 8 PM ET
Where: Superdome, New Orleans
How to watch: This game is being broadcast on Fox Sports 1 and streamed on Fox Sports Go.
Last meeting: The United States beat China 2-0 this past weekend at the University of Phoenix Stadium in Glendale.
Players to watch: Obviously this is Abby Wambach's last international game ever. She hasn't been up for more than 10 or 15 minutes in the last few games, so Jill Ellis may start her for as long as she can run and then sub her off to the crowd, or she might leave Wambach as a late sub so that she ends her career on the field.
Other than that, this could finally be the game where Ellis gives Danielle Colaprico some minutes after talking her up as someone she'd like to see in camp. Ellis also seems very keen on seeing how relative newcomers Lindsey Horan, Stephanie McCaffrey, and Jaelene Hinkle fit into her lineup, so they could all receive substantial minutes. Horan especially needs to prove she can consistently handle stiffer opposition in midfield.
